Transaction 21d8504c1b160f7776a5f93202c04e90c85233579ff8b731eb2b4c9fecaff30d

1 Input
2 Outputs
  • 21d8504c1b160f7776a5f93202c04e90c85233579ff8b731eb2b4c9fecaff30d:0
  • value  12841774900
    address  14yTmQRv3bHJiwRHwxj5gFrmUPPLKK6t5z
  • 21d8504c1b160f7776a5f93202c04e90c85233579ff8b731eb2b4c9fecaff30d:1
  • value  42842000
    address  146e3WiPHyj1VGKjHWRn1R7NY7czuhXAaB